Web16 May 2024 · Icy Ocean Sensory Play Use ordinary food storage containers to mold mini oceans. Add items in layers so that there is lots of fun things to unfreeze with this ocean theme ice play. Icy Dinosaur Eggs These frozen dinosaur eggs are perfect for your dinosaur fan and an easy ice activity! Web6. Helps to calm & organize. What is it? The act of calming & organizing the child’s body is the result of the use of the proprioceptive sense when blowing bubbles. Proprioceptive sense is found in body’s joints, muscles and ligaments. It is activated when these parts are being stretched and compressed.
